Starting a new business can be an exciting yet challenging journey, especially in a dynamic and competitive environment like the UAE. For many entrepreneurs, the early stages of a business setup come with a steep learning curve. From understanding legal formalities to developing the right strategy, each step can be time-consuming if done without guidance. That’s where the support of a business mentor becomes invaluable.
A business mentor brings real-world experience, insights, and practical knowledge that can significantly shorten the time it takes to launch a successful business. Whether you’re setting up a small enterprise or entering a new industry, having someone who has walked the path before you can make a huge difference. Their advice can help you navigate challenges efficiently and make informed decisions during the business setup phase.
One of the key advantages of having a mentor is clarity. When you’re new to the business world, it’s easy to get overwhelmed with the number of decisions you need to make. A mentor helps you stay focused on your goals and avoid common mistakes that many first-time business owners face. From selecting the right legal structure to building a strong operational foundation, a mentor ensures your setup process is smooth and strategic.
Another area where a business mentor can help is in time management. Many entrepreneurs waste valuable time figuring things out on their own. With a mentor, you benefit from tried-and-tested strategies that have worked before. This not only accelerates your progress but also gives you more confidence to move forward. Their guidance can help you avoid unnecessary delays, which is especially critical during the early stages of a business setup.
Additionally, a mentor provides honest feedback. They see the bigger picture and help you evaluate your ideas objectively. Instead of relying solely on trial and error, you gain insights that help you adjust your plan when necessary. This practical guidance can often be the difference between a smooth launch and a stressful one.
Networking is another area where mentors add great value. They often have a wide range of connections that can open doors for your business. Whether you need help finding suppliers, hiring skilled professionals, or connecting with industry experts, a mentor can introduce you to the right people. This not only saves time but also builds credibility as you begin your business journey.
Importantly, business mentors are also a source of motivation. The process of setting up a business can be filled with highs and lows. Having someone by your side who understands your struggles and cheers on your progress can boost your morale. Their encouragement helps you stay committed, especially during challenging times.
